    When I think of underrated games, what comes to mind is these 5 games:

    Earthbound - A SNES cult classic; a funny and charming RPG
    Final Fantasy IX - A great FF game on the PS1; Great story and more in common with the SNES/NES FFs.
    Jet Force Gemini - Great N64 Rare game; A third person shooter that's good for it's time.
    Psychonauts - A cult classic on the PS2/Xbox/PC; a good platformer with witty humor.
    Jet Grind Radio - A great game on the Dreamcast; A game based on rollerblading and graffiti with great gameplay and concept.
